¿Cómo cifrar caracteres y números en un lenguaje sencillo?
.Ensamblaje de ventana de ensamblaje 1
.Subroutine_Button1_is_clicked
' Esto está cifrado
Escribir entrada de configuración ( get rundir()+"\config.ini","data","data1",to text(datos cifrados(to byteset(editbox1.content)),"completa lo que quieras aquí. El contenido deseado, pero después del descifrado es igual que el contenido completado aquí", algoritmo #RC4)))
Escriba el elemento de configuración (tome el directorio de ejecución () + "\configuration.ini", "data", "data2", Convertir a texto (datos cifrados (convertir a conjunto de bytes (cuadro de edición 2. contenido)), "Complete lo que desee aquí, pero será el mismo que completó aquí después del descifrado", algoritmo #RC4)))
. Se hizo clic en la subrutina _Botón 2_
' Descifrado aquí
Cuadro de edición 1.content = a texto (descifrar datos (al conjunto de bytes (leer la entrada de configuración (tomar el directorio de ejecución) + "\ config.ini", "data", "Data 1", )), "Completa lo que quieras aquí, pero descifralo de la misma manera que lo completas aquí", algoritmo #RC4))
Editar cuadro 2.content = a texto (descifrar datos (al conjunto de bytes (leer la entrada de configuración (tomar el directorio de ejecución () + "\config.ini", "datos", "Datos 1", )), "Complete lo que desee) aquí, pero descifrelo de la misma manera que lo completa aquí", algoritmo #RC4))
.content = to text (descifrar datos (to byteset (leer la entrada de configuración (buscar directorio de ejecución)) + " \config.ini", "data", "data2", )), "Completa lo que quieras aquí, pero descifralo de la misma manera que lo completas aquí", algoritmo #RC4))
Editar cuadro 2.